refactor(api): 简化 dataclass 转换逻辑并添加好友/群列表缓存
移除冗余的 _safe_dataclass_from_dict 工具函数,直接使用 dataclass 的构造方法 添加 get_friend_list 和 get_group_list 方法的缓存支持 修复 get_version_info 的错误 API 调用
This commit is contained in:
@@ -11,6 +11,7 @@ from typing import Any, Callable, Dict, Optional, Tuple
|
||||
from models.events.message import MessageSegment
|
||||
|
||||
|
||||
|
||||
from ..config_loader import global_config
|
||||
from ..handlers.event_handler import MessageHandler, NoticeHandler, RequestHandler
|
||||
from .redis_manager import redis_manager
|
||||
|
||||
Reference in New Issue
Block a user